Problems solved by technology

First, the method provides only two characteristics of biomolecules—mass and isoelectric point (pI)
Second, the resolution in each dimension is limited by the resolving power of the gel
For example, it is often difficult to distinguish between biomolecules that differ by less than 5% in mass or that differ in pI
Third, gels have limited capacity and sensitivity and may not be able to detect small amounts of expressed biomolecules
Fourth, small proteins or peptides with a molecular weight below about 10-20 kDa cannot be observed
Since human cell proteins are much more complex than potatoes, electrophoresis alone to identify protein fingerprints of diseases is far from meeting clinical needs

[0062] Embodiment 1 Normal people, nephrotic syndrome and lupus erythematosus nephritis in the distinction of protein fingerprint in urine

[0063] (1) Experimental method

[0064] 1. Materials

[0065] 1. Source of specimens: There were 36 nephrotic syndrome patients in the nephrotic syndrome group. There were 30 patients with lupus erythematosus erythematosus in the lupus erythematosus nephritis group. There were 32 normal people in the normal group.

[0066] 2. Reagents: urea, acetonitrile, trifluoroacetic acid, and SPA (Sinapinic acid) were all purchased from Sigma.

[0067] 2. Method

[0068] 1. Collection of samples: Urine was collected in the middle of the morning.

[0069] 2. Sample preparation: take 100 μl of urine, centrifuge at 14,000 rpm for 5 minutes, absorb the supernatant, and store at -70°C.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a novel method for analyzing proteins in biological samples, in particular to a protein fingerprint method for analyzing biological samples. The present invention also relates to protein fingerprinting in which the proteome is captured by retention chromatography and analyzed using a computer readable barcode format (protein fingerprint). Background technique [0002] Both normal function and pathological characteristics of cells depend to some extent on the function of proteins expressed by cells. Therefore, identifying differences in proteins expressed within cells can be used in the diagnosis of disease and ultimately in drug development and disease treatment. However, differential analysis of protein expression and function requires the ability to resolve complex mixtures of intracellular molecules.
